Gardener/Groundsperson

  • Estates Division - Facilities
  • Salary: 23,144- 25,742
  • Closing date: 14th April 2024

About you: Estates Division is looking to recruit a Gardener/Grounds Person to provide assistance to the senior grounds supervisor in all duties connected with grounds maintenance around the Universities estate.

As part of a grounds team, you will provide front line support to University Departments by undertaking the routine grounds care and maintenance throughout the seasons.

The ideal candidate will have a good general education with some experienced grounds or garden maintenance. You should have a friendly approach and an ability to work alone or as a team member. This is a great opportunity to work in and around the vast University estate, which is rapidly expanding.

A full British driving licence is essential.
